Anthropic users debate Cowork vs. Claude Code for project management

A user on Reddit is seeking to understand the differences and preferred use cases between Anthropic's "Cowork" and "Claude Code" features. The user, a startup founder, has experience organizing project files and information and is exploring how to best manage cohesive information across different tasks. They are currently experimenting with Claude Code to build a business operating system with automatic memory refresh and a Notion connection, and are asking for community input on the pros and cons of each tool.
